According to Business Market Insights research, the South & Central America sports sunglasses market was valued at US$ 519.41 million in 2022 and is expected to reach US$ 824.50 million by 2030, registering a CAGR of 5.9% from 2022 to 2030. Upsurging participation in sports activities and emerging inclination toward sustainable and eco-friendly products are among the critical factors attributed to the South & Central America sports sunglasses market expansion.

Growing awareness regarding sustainable and eco-friendly products and commitment to environmental responsibility among consumers and manufacturers propel the demand for products aligning with their eco-conscious values. As environmental concerns become pronounced, individuals participating in outdoor activities and sports seek products that minimize their ecological footprint. Sports sunglasses made of sustainable materials, such as recycled plastics, bamboo, or other biodegradable options, gain popularity. These materials reduce the environmental impact of manufacturing and offer a sustainable end-of-life cycle, which resonates with eco-conscious consumers.

Furthermore, eco-friendly manufacturing processes and practices are becoming a focal point in the sports sunglasses market. Brands are reducing waste, minimizing energy consumption, and lowering their carbon footprint while producing eyewear. This commitment to sustainable practices enhances the brand's reputation and resonates with consumers who prioritize environment-friendly products. Sea2see, a sustainable premium eyewear brand, offers sports sunglasses made of 100% up-cycled sea plastic. Also, uvex group, a manufacturer of protective eyewear, offers uvex downhill 2100 CV planet ski goggles made of consistently sustainable materials - from lens to strap. This product received an award in the "product design" category in 2022. According to the jury, the uvex downhill 2100 CV planet design remarkably cleverly responds to the desire of an environmentally conscious generation of consumers to combine sustainability and modern design. Such product launches and initiatives by various manufacturers fulfill the demand of environment-conscious consumers.

Furthermore, in response to this trend, some manufacturers are embracing circular economy principles, offering repair and recycling programs for their sports sunglasses. This approach extends the lifespan of products and minimizes waste, appealing to consumers looking for long-lasting and sustainable eyewear options. By integrating sustainability into their core values, companies are capitalizing on a growing demand for eco-friendly sports sunglasses and contributing to a more environmentally responsible sports industry.

Based on type, the South & Central America sports sunglasses market is bifurcated into polarized and non-polarized. The non-polarized segment held 74.5% share of South & Central America sports sunglasses market in 2022, amassing US$ 386.83 million. It is projected to garner US$ 602.24 million by 2030 to expand at 5.7% CAGR during 2022-2030.

Based on category, the South & Central America sports sunglasses market is segmented into men, women, unisex, and kids. The men segment held 45.8% share of South & Central America sports sunglasses market in 2022, amassing US$ 237.86 million. It is projected to garner US$ 352.64 million by 2030 to expand at 5.0% CAGR during 2022-2030.

Based on distribution channel, the South & Central America sports sunglasses market is segmented into supermarkets and hypermarkets, specialty stores, online retail, and others. The specialty stores segment held 52.4% share of South & Central America sports sunglasses market in 2022, amassing US$ 271.97 million. It is projected to garner US$ 440.02 million by 2030 to expand at 6.2% CAGR during 2022-2030.

Based on country, the South & Central America sports sunglasses market has been categorized into Brazil, Argentina, and the Rest of South & Central America. Our regional analysis states that the Rest of South & Central America captured 47.6% share of South & Central America sports sunglasses market in 2022. It was assessed at US$ 247.43 million in 2022 and is likely to hit US$ 375.68 million by 2030, exhibiting a CAGR of 5.4% during 2022-2030.
